I didn’t know what to say until I spoke to Ella.
until意为“直到……为止”,引导时间状语从句时,表示主句动作持续到从句动作发生或状态出现为止。
1. 肯定句用法
结构:主句动词为延续性动词(如wait, stay, work, live等),表示主句动作一直持续到until时间点结束。
例:He waited until the rain stopped.他一直等到雨停。
Language points
I didn’t know what to say until I spoke to Ella.
2. 否定句用法
结构:主句动词为短暂性动词(如leave, start, finish, realize等),构成“not...until...”结构,意为“直到……才”。
例:She didn’t leave until the teacher arrived.
直到老师来了她才离开。
Language points
I didn’t know what to say until I spoke to Ella.
until&till
until 和 till 它俩既可作介词,又可作连词,引出时间状语或时间状语从句。till 和 until 后面可以跟名词、代词、副词、介词短语或从句。
Language points
until用在书面语或更正式场合中。till则常用于口语或非正式场合中。
在句首使用时,通常使用 until,而很少使用till。
We should talk so that we can clear the air.
so that 表示 “为了;以便”(目的)或 “结果是;以至于”(结果),引导目的状语从句时,常与情态动词 can/could/may/might 连用;引导结果状语从句时,从句前可加逗号,且无需情态动词。
结构:主句 + so that + 从句(目的 / 结果)
Language points
目的:She studies hard so that she can pass the exam.
她努力学习是为了能通过考试。
结果:He shouted loudly, so that everyone turned to look at him.
他大声喊叫,结果所有人都转头看他。
We should talk so that we can clear the air.
so...that 表示 “如此…… 以至于……”,强调形容词或副词的程度,引导结果状语从句。
结构:so + 形容词 / 副词 + that + 从句。
注意:
如果名词前有 many/much/few/little(表示 “数量多少”)修饰,即使是名词,也用 so 而不用 such,即 “so + many/much/few/little + 名词 + that 从句”。
Language points
We should talk so that we can clear the air.
例:
The movie is so interesting that I want to watch it again.
这部电影如此有趣,以至于我想再看一遍。(so + 形容词)
He ran so fast that no one could catch up with him.
他跑得如此快,以至于没人能追上他。(so + 副词)
There are so many people in the park that we can’t move freely.
公园里人太多,以至于我们无法自由走动。(so + many + 名词)
Language points
He’s not around anymore.
not...anymore用于表达“不再、再也不”,强调过去存在的情况或行为现在已终止,常带有“以前是,现在不是”的对比意味。
Language points
1. 位置: 通常放在句末,与否定形式搭配使用。
2. 结构:主语 + 助动词/be动词 + not + ... + anymore.
例:She doesn't live here anymore. 她不再住在这里了。
I can't write anymore. 我再也写不下去了。
